使用阿里云文字识别OCR服务进行图片文字提取时,如果需要使用自定义模板,您可以按照以下步骤进行调用:
在阿里云控制台开启OCR服务并购买相应的资源包,确保已经具备使用自定义模板的权限。
在控制台中创建自定义模板。您可以进入OCR服务的页面,选择自定义模板,然后点击创建模板按钮。在创建模板时,您可以指定模板中的各种元素和规则,如文本、表格、区域、关键词等。
在调用OCR服务时,将自定义模板应用于识别。您可以通过设置请求参数来指定要使用的自定义模板。例如,可以在调用接口时,将Config
对象的TemplateId
字段设置为您创建的自定义模板的ID。
以下是一个示例的API请求参数,用于调用OCR服务并使用自定义模板:
{
"ImageURL": "http://your-image-url.jpg",
"Type": "custom",
"Config": {
"TemplateId": "your-template-id"
}
}
请将your-image-url.jpg
替换为要识别的图片的URL,将your-template-id
替换为您创建的自定义模板的ID。
使用阿里文字识别OCR的图片文字提取功能时,您可以通过自定义模板来指定需要提取的文本字段和其位置。以下是使用自定义模板调用的一般步骤:
创建自定义模板:首先,您需要创建一个自定义模板,定义需要提取的文本字段和其位置。您可以使用阿里云的OCR控制台或API来创建自定义模板。在创建模板时,您可以指定字段的名称、位置、大小、字体样式等信息。
上传图片:将需要提取文字的图片上传到阿里云的OCR服务。您可以使用API调用或SDK上传图片。
调用OCR接口:使用OCR服务的API调用或SDK,指定使用自定义模板进行图片文字提取。在API请求中,您需要提供自定义模板的ID或名称,以及要提取文字的图片。
解析结果:获取OCR接口的响应结果,解析提取的文本信息。根据自定义模板的定义,您可以从响应结果中提取指定字段的文本内容。
自定义KV模板是针对卡证、票据等固定版式的数据提供的一款定制化产品。用户仅需通过一张模板数据的可视化拖拉拽配置,无需进行数据标注和模型训练,即可实现相同版式数据的自定义结构化识别抽取。经过配置调优的模板识别准确率可达85%以上。https://help.aliyun.com/document_detail/603348.html?spm=a2c4g.442247.0.i0
使用阿里云文字识别OCR服务进行图片文字提取时,可以使用自定义模板进行更精准的识别。以下是调用步骤:
创建自定义模板:在阿里云控制台的"文字识别OCR"服务中,进入"自定义模板管理",点击"新增模板",按照指引创建自定义模板,并记录下模板的ID。
调用API进行文字识别:使用阿里云SDK或者API工具,调用文字识别OCR的接口,其中需要指定自定义模板的ID。
请求参数示例:
{
"ImageURL": "图片URL",
"Config": "{\"TemplateId\":\"自定义模板ID\"}"
}
注意:自定义模板的创建和使用需要按照阿里云文字识别OCR的相关文档和指引进行操作,确保模板的定义和使用正确。
使用文字识别OCR进行自定义模板的文字提取,您需要按照以下步骤进行调用:
创建自定义模板:在文字识别OCR服务中,您需要先创建一个自定义模板,定义您希望识别的文本位置和结构。您可以通过API接口或者可视化工具创建自定义模板。
上传图片:将带有需要识别的文字的图片上传到文字识别OCR服务。
调用文字识别接口:使用API接口调用文字识别OCR服务,并指定使用自定义模板进行识别。
解析识别结果:接收到文字识别OCR的响应后,解析识别结果,提取所需的文本内容。
需要注意的是,自定义模板的创建和调用方法可能因不同的文字识别OCR服务提供商而有所不同,您可以参考该服务提供商的文档或API文档以了解具体的调用方法和参数设置。
使用自定义模板进行OCR图片文字提取,通常需要进行以下几个步骤:
准备OCR算法和模型:OCR算法和模型是OCR识别的核心部分,需要根据识别场景和需求进行选择和优化。如果您需要使用自定义模板进行OCR识别,可以基于通用OCR模型进行训练,也可以自行开发和训练OCR算法和模型。
创建自定义模板:根据需要提取的文本内容和布局,创建自定义模板,包括文本区域、文本行、文本框等元素。可以使用图像处理软件或在线OCR服务提供商的自定义模板创建工具进行创建。
配置OCR识别API和接口:OCR识别API和接口是OCR服务的核心功能,需要根据业务需求和识别场景进行配置和优化。可以使用OCR服务提供商提供的API和接口,或者自行开发和优化OCR API和接口,以支持自定义模板的识别。
在文字识别OCR中,使用自定义模板可以帮助提高对特定类型文档的识别效果。以下是使用自定义模板进行图片文字提取的一般步骤:
创建自定义模板:首先,您需要创建一个自定义模板,定义该模板适用的文档类型和结构。您可以通过阿里云控制台或使用API进行模板的创建和配置。在模板中,您可以指定需要提取的字段、字段的位置和格式等信息。
上传样本图像:为了训练自定义模板,您需要上传一些样本图像,这些图像应代表待识别的文档类型。确保样本图像包含不同样式和变化的文本示例,以提高模板的泛化能力。
训练模板:将上传的样本图像用于训练自定义模板。此过程将基于样本图像中的文本来学习模板的特征和规则。请注意,训练模板可能需要一定时间,请耐心等待。
调用OCR服务:在进行图片文字提取时,通过API调用OCR服务,并指定使用自定义模板进行识别。在API请求中,将图像数据作为输入,并将模板ID或名称作为参数传递,以告知OCR服务使用哪个自定义模板。
解析识别结果:OCR服务将返回响应,其中包含基于自定义模板的识别结果。您可以解析响应以获取提取的字段和文本内容,并根据需要进行进一步处理或分析。
请注意,使用自定义模板进行图片文字提取可能需要额外的配置和调试,并且需要足够的样本数据进行训练。此外,模板的准确性和泛化能力可能受到图像质量、模板设计和训练数据的影响。
版权声明:本文内容由阿里云实名注册用户自发贡献,版权归原作者所有,阿里云开发者社区不拥有其著作权,亦不承担相应法律责任。具体规则请查看《阿里云开发者社区用户服务协议》和《阿里云开发者社区知识产权保护指引》。如果您发现本社区中有涉嫌抄袭的内容,填写侵权投诉表单进行举报,一经查实,本社区将立刻删除涉嫌侵权内容。